/* [project]/src/app/(paginas)/sessao-aovivo/styles.module.css [app-client] (css) */
#styles-module__O2pAla__recipiente_sessao_prevista {
  text-align: center;
  width: 100%;
  height: 100%;
  padding: 2%;
}

#styles-module__O2pAla__recipiente_pagina_sessao {
  border: 1.4vh solid #0000;
  border-width: 1.4vh .63vw;
  border-radius: 12vh;
  width: 100%;
  height: 100%;
  position: relative;
}

#styles-module__O2pAla__recipiente_espaco_sessao {
  flex-direction: column;
  height: 100%;
  padding: 1.7vw 2.2vw;
  display: flex;
}

#styles-module__O2pAla__recipiente_titulo_sessao {
  flex-direction: row;
  flex: 1 0 14.3%;
  justify-content: center;
  align-items: center;
  width: 100%;
  display: flex;
  overflow: hidden;
}

#styles-module__O2pAla__udm {
  box-sizing: border-box;
  color: #0000;
  -webkit-text-stroke: 3px #727272;
  text-shadow: 0 0 12px #0006;
  letter-spacing: .3vw;
  align-items: stretch;
  font-family: Courier New, Courier, monospace;
  font-size: 9rem;
  font-weight: bolder;
  line-height: 6rem;
}

#styles-module__O2pAla__recipiente_corpo_sessao {
  flex-direction: row;
  flex: 1 0 85.7%;
  display: flex;
}

#styles-module__O2pAla__recipiente_esquerda_tela_jogo {
  flex-direction: column;
  flex: 1 0 19.1%;
  padding: 0 1vw 0 0;
  display: flex;
}

#styles-module__O2pAla__recipiente_nome_aventura {
  text-align: center;
  color: #0000;
  -webkit-text-stroke: 2px #727272;
  text-shadow: 0 0 12px #0006;
}

#styles-module__O2pAla__recipiente_lista_retratos {
  flex-flow: wrap;
  place-content: flex-start space-around;
  gap: 1.5vh 1vw;
  height: 100%;
  padding: 1vh 0;
  display: flex;
}

.styles-module__O2pAla__recipiente_retrato {
  aspect-ratio: 1;
  border-radius: 1.5vw;
  flex: 0 0 46%;
  height: fit-content;
  position: relative;
  overflow: hidden;
  box-shadow: 8px 6px 10px #0000008c;
}

#styles-module__O2pAla__recipiente_tela_jogo {
  border: 1vh solid #000;
  border-width: 1vh .58vw;
  border-radius: 6vh;
  flex: 1 0 80.9%;
  position: relative;
  overflow: hidden;
}

#styles-module__O2pAla__recipiente_pagina_sessao_emandamento {
  border: 1.4vh solid #0000;
  border-width: 1.4vh .63vw;
  border-radius: 12vh;
  width: 100%;
  height: 100%;
  position: relative;
}


/* [project]/src/componentes/ElementosVisuais/PaginaAterrissagem/Cabecalho/styles.module.css [app-client] (css) */
#styles-module__WlqLdG__cabecalho {
  flex-direction: row;
  width: 90%;
  height: 13vh;
  display: flex;
  position: relative;
}

#styles-module__WlqLdG__cabecalho_esquerda {
  flex-direction: row;
  flex: .15;
  height: 100%;
  display: flex;
}

#styles-module__WlqLdG__recipiente_logo {
  flex: 1;
  align-items: center;
  margin: 6%;
  display: flex;
  position: relative;
}

#styles-module__WlqLdG__recipiente_logo a {
  width: 100%;
}

#styles-module__WlqLdG__cabecalho_direita {
  flex-direction: row;
  flex: 1;
  align-items: center;
  height: 100%;
  display: flex;
}

#styles-module__WlqLdG__cabecalho_direita_linha {
  flex: 1;
  align-items: center;
  height: 100%;
  display: flex;
  position: relative;
}

#styles-module__WlqLdG__cabecalho_direita_acesso {
  flex: .23;
  align-items: center;
  height: 100%;
  display: flex;
  position: relative;
}

#styles-module__WlqLdG__recipiente_linha_cabecalho {
  width: 100.5%;
  height: 100%;
  position: absolute;
}


/* [project]/src/componentes/ElementosVisuais/BotaoAcessar/styles.module.css [app-client] (css) */
#styles-module__FY3GNa__recipiente_svg_botao_acesso {
  width: 100%;
  height: 100%;
}


/* [project]/src/componentes/Elementos/Chat/styles.module.css [app-client] (css) */
#styles-module__FRID-G__recipiente_chat {
  width: 30%;
  height: 2.2rem;
  z-index: calc(var(--zindex-final-chat)  - 0);
  background-color: #000c;
  border: 1px solid #b79051;
  border-radius: 1vh;
  flex-direction: row;
  gap: 1%;
  padding: .4vh .3vw;
  display: flex;
  position: absolute;
  bottom: 2%;
  left: 2%;
}

#styles-module__FRID-G__recipiente_icone_chat {
  height: 100%;
  position: relative;
}

#styles-module__FRID-G__recipiente_icone_chat svg {
  color: #d2c31a;
  transform: scaleX(-1);
}

#styles-module__FRID-G__recipiente_campo_texto_chat {
  flex: 1;
}

#styles-module__FRID-G__recipiente_campo_texto_chat input {
  all: unset;
  width: 100%;
  height: 100%;
  font-size: 1.3rem;
}


/*# sourceMappingURL=src_71ea0fae._.css.map*/